关于cout对各进制输出的预定义

    using std::cout;
    int n=64;
    /*cout默认输出十进制数据*/
    cout<<std::hex;    //这里将cout预定义为16进制输出
    cout<<n;
    cout<<std::oct;    //这里将cout预定义为8进制输出
    cout<<" "<<n;
    cout<<std::dec;	   //这里将cout预定义为10进制输出
    cout<<" "<<n;

输出

40 100 64

猜你喜欢

转载自blog.csdn.net/qq_43477024/article/details/107984047